All rights reserved. http://www.usgwarchives.net/copyright.htm http://www.usgwarchives.net/sc/scfiles.htm ************************************************ File contributed for use in USGenWeb Archives by: Patti Burns Patti.Burns@hgtc.edu May 10, 2007, 1:55 pm Horry Herald February 13, 1919 On January 25, 1919, the death angel visited the home of Rev. and Mrs. D. B. Causey and took from them their infant son, Harvey Winston. He was only one month and three days old. His little life on earth was short but very precious to the family. It was so hard to part with little Harvey so early in life but we must be submissive to God’s will. He leaves Father and Mother, four sisters and one brother besides a host of friends and relatives to mourn their loss. But we know that our loss is his eternal gain. Thou are gone, our precious darling; Never more canst thou return. Thou shall sleep a peaceful slumber till the resurrection morning, and on that morning we will meet, little Harvey, to part no more. Little Harvey was laid to rest in the Singleton graveyard near Toddville, S. C., the day after his death.
